报文交换是一种常见的通信传输方式,用于在计算机网络中传输数据。它是一种端到端的通信模式,其中数据被封装为称为报文的数据块,并通过网络传输到目的地。报文交换的主要目的是确保数据的可靠传输,并维护通信的完整性和连续性。在报文交换中,每份报文都包含发送和接收控制信息,以确保正确的传输和顺序的恢复。报文交换被广泛应用于各种网络协议和通信技术中,包括互联网的基础协议TCP/IP。
1.什么是报文交换?
报文交换是一种通信传输方式,它通过将数据封装为报文并在网络中传输来实现数据的交换和传递。报文是一种逻辑上的数据单位,它包含了数据的内容和相应的控制信息。控制信息用于指示报文的发送和接收,保证传输的正确性和顺序性。
在报文交换中,数据被划分为较小的数据块,每个数据块被称为一个报文。报文交换采用存储转发的方式,在发送端将整个报文一次性发送到网络中,然后在每一个中间节点或目标节点对报文进行处理,最后在接收端将报文组装成完整的数据。
2.报文交换有什么特点?
2.1 灵活性和可扩展性
报文交换具有灵活性和可扩展性的特点。由于数据被划分为较小的报文,它可以适应不同大小和类型的数据传输。无论是小型数据还是大型文件,报文交换都可以处理,并可以根据网络流量的需求进行扩展。
2.2 可靠传输
报文交换确保数据的可靠传输。每个报文中都包含有关发送和接收的控制信息,以保证报文的正确到达和顺序恢复。如果一个报文在传输过程中丢失或损坏,接收端可以通过报文中的控制信息请求重新发送,从而实现可靠的传输。
2.3 适应不同网络环境
报文交换适应不同的网络环境,无论是局域网还是广域网。报文交换不依赖于特定的物理媒体或传输技术,因此可以在各种网络类型和架构中使用,包括以太网、无线网络和光纤网络等。
2.4 简化网络协议和通信
报文交换简化了网络协议和通信过程。每个报文都包含发送和接收的信息,使得网络设备和协议可以更轻松地处理数据的传输和路由。它提供了一种高效的端到端通信方式,使得数据交换更加可靠和高效。
总而言之,报文交换是一种常见的通信传输方式,通过将数据封装为报文并在网络中传输来实现数据的交换和传递。它具有灵活性、可靠传输、适应不同网络环境和简化网络协议和通信等特点。报文交换在计算机网络和通信技术中扮演着重要的角色,为数据的可靠传输提供了基础。